Start at Home:
* Kitchen Crusaders:
Reduce food waste by planning meals, using leftovers creatively (think delicious frittatas!), and composting scraps. Opt for reusable containers instead of cling film, and swap single-use paper towels for cloth napkins or reusable sponges.
* Bathroom Buddies:
Switch to bar soap and shampoo bars to minimize plastic packaging. Invest in a bamboo toothbrush and consider refillable cleaning products. Shorter showers save water and energy!
* Laundry Legends:
Wash clothes in cold water whenever possible, hang dry your laundry (a sun-dried scent is the best!), and choose eco-friendly detergents.
* Energy Efficient Explorers:
Unplug electronics when not in use, switch to LED bulbs for brighter, longer-lasting light, and adjust your thermostat a few degrees for energy savings.
Beyond Your Walls:
* Conscious Consumer:
Support local businesses and farmers markets whenever possible. Choose products with minimal packaging or opt for refillable options. When buying new items, consider their lifespan and durability – quality over quantity!
* Transportation Trailblazers:
Walk, bike, or use public transportation whenever feasible. Carpool with friends or colleagues, and explore electric vehicle options if your lifestyle allows.
* Advocate Activist:
Stay informed about environmental issues in your community and support organizations working towards positive change.
